How We Handle Bathroom Water Damage Restoration
Water damage in a bathroom isn’t something to take lightly. The right process matters. If you rush through it, you risk long-term damage and health issues. Our team follows a structured plan that includes containment, water extraction, drying, and sanitization. We use industrial-grade equipment like air movers and dehumidifiers to speed up the process. You don’t need to guess what’s happening. We measure moisture levels and track progress to make sure everything is handled properly. This is how we protect your home and your investment.
Assessment and Containment
Our technicians start by assessing the damage. They look for standing water, wet materials, and potential hazards. They contain the area to prevent the spread of water and mold. This step is crucial for keeping your home safe. You don’t want the problem to get worse. We use barriers and fans to control the environment. It’s the first step in a fast, effective solution.
Water Extraction
Once the area is contained, we remove standing water with powerful extraction tools. This step is fast and efficient. You don’t want water sitting for long. We use high-capacity pumps to get rid of the water quickly. This helps prevent structural damage and mold growth. It’s the foundation of a successful restoration. You can trust us to do this right.
Drying and Dehumidification
After we extract the water, we move on to drying. We use air movers and dehumidifiers to remove moisture from the air and surfaces. This is where the science comes in. We track moisture levels with meters to make sure everything is dry. You don’t want lingering dampness. We keep working until the area is fully dry. This is how we protect your home from long-term damage.
Sanitization and Disinfection
Once the area is dry, we clean and disinfect all surfaces. We use EPA-approved products to kill bacteria and prevent mold. This step is essential for your health and safety. You don’t want to live in a damp, dirty space. We make sure everything is safe and clean. You can trust us to handle this part of the process properly.
Final Inspection and Restoration
We do a final inspection to make sure everything is working as it should. We check for any remaining moisture and ensure the space is ready for use. If needed, we replace damaged materials. Warning Signs You Need Bathroom Water Damage Restoration
Water damage in your bathroom doesn’t always show up right away. You might not notice it until it’s too late. Catching these signs early can save you money and prevent bigger problems. If you see any of these, it’s time to call a professional. You don’t want to risk your home or your health.
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
You smell a damp, moldy smell that doesn’t go away. It’s not just a passing smell. It’s a sign of hidden moisture. You don’t want to live in a space that smells bad. This is a red flag. It means mold is growing and you need help. Don’t ignore it. You could be putting your health at risk.
Discolored Walls or Ceilings
You see dark spots or stains on your walls or ceiling. They look like water damage. You might think it’s just a stain, but it’s more than that. It’s a sign of moisture that’s been there for a while. You don’t want to cover it up. You need to find the source. This is a warning that the problem is spreading.
Warped or Buckling Flooring
Your floor feels soft underfoot or looks warped. It’s not just an aesthetic issue. It’s a sign of water damage. You don’t want to walk on a floor that’s not stable. It could lead to more damage or even collapse. You need to act now. This is a serious sign that should not be ignored.
Water Stains on Fixtures or Surfaces
You see dark stains on your sink, toilet, or shower. These are signs of water that has been sitting for a long time. You might not see the water, but it’s there. It’s a sign that something is wrong. You need to check for leaks. This is a sign that the problem is ongoing and needs attention.
High Humidity Levels
Your bathroom feels damp and humid even after you’ve dried it. You might be using a fan, but the air still feels heavy. This is a sign of moisture that’s not going away. You don’t want to live in a space that’s always wet. It can lead to mold growth and other issues. You need to fix the source of the problem.
Visible Mold Growth
You see black or green spots on your walls, shower, or floor. This is a clear sign of mold. You don’t want to live in a space that’s contaminated. Mold can cause health problems and spread quickly. You need to act now. This is a serious issue that should be handled by professionals.
Bathroom Water Damage Restoration v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Small puddle on the floor | Yes | No | It’s manageable if you act fast. But don’t ignore it. |
| Water under the toilet or sink | No | Yes | This could be a hidden leak. You need to find the source. |
| Standing water over 2 inches deep | No | Yes | This is serious. You need professional extraction tools. |
| Mold already growing in the area | No | Yes | Mold is dangerous and hard to remove. You need help. |
| Water damage in the walls or ceiling | No | Yes | This is hidden damage. You can’t fix it on your own. |
| Water has been sitting for more than 48 hours | No | Yes | The longer it sits, the worse it gets. You need help. |

Bathroom Water Damage Restoration Cost In Kellogg, ID
Bathroom Water Damage Restoration costs vary depending on the size of the area and the extent of the damage. You can expect to pay between $500 and $2,500 for basic services. More complex issues can cost more. You don’t want to guess. It’s best to get a professional estimate. This is how we make sure you’re getting a fair price for the work done.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water Extraction | $300 – $1,000 | Amount of water and how quickly it’s removed. |
| Drying and Dehumidification | $500 – $1,500 | Size of the area and how long it takes to dry. |
| Sanitization | $200 – $600 | Level of contamination and materials involved. |
| Mold Remediation | $1,000 – $3,000 | Extent of mold growth and affected areas. |
| Repair and Replacement | $500 – $2,000 | Damage to flooring, walls, or fixtures. |
| Final Inspection | $100 – $300 | Time and effort required to complete the job. |
